Tip 1: Familiarize Ourselves with the Owner’s Manual

Before we start operating our John Deere tractor, it’s vital to thoroughly read and understand the owner’s manual. This is our first line of defense in ensuring not only our safety but also the longevity of the equipment that we rely on. The owner’s manual is more than just a collection of instructions; it’s a comprehensive guide packed with crucial information that can significantly enhance our operational experience.

Understanding Specifications and Operating Procedures

Every model of John Deere tractor comes with distinct specifications that dictate how it should be operated and maintained. By familiarizing ourselves with these details, we ensure that we use the machine effectively. For instance, knowing the recommended load limits prevents us from overburdening the tractor, which can lead to mechanical failure. Each model, be it the John Deere 1025R or the John Deere 3038E, may have specific instructions regarding speed limits, attachment guidelines, and fuel requirements.

Safety Features to Note

One of the most beneficial aspects of the owner’s manual is the section dedicated to safety features. These can include everything from roll-over protection systems (ROPS) to specific braking techniques. Understanding how and when to utilize these safety features could make the difference between a smooth ride and a hazardous situation. Imagine navigating a steep incline; knowing how to engage the brakes effectively could save not just our tractor but possibly prevent serious injuries as well.

Maintenance Schedules for Longevity

The manual is also our guide for maintenance schedules that keep the tractor in peak condition. Inside, we’ll find valuable tips on oil changes, filter replacements, and scheduled inspections that are crucial for avoiding costly repairs down the line. Regularly checking tire pressure, for example, ensures better traction and fuel efficiency. Without this knowledge, we may unintentionally overlook essential upkeep, which could lead to operational failures when we’re deep into work.

Tip 2: Always Wear Appropriate Safety Gear

When we step into the cab of our John Deere tractor, wearing appropriate safety gear becomes our first line of defense against potential hazards. The nature of tractor operation involves exposure to various risks—from moving parts to debris flying in the air. Thus, investing in personal protective equipment (PPE) is not just smart; it’s essential for our safety and well-being.

Essential Safety Gear Components

Let’s break down the key safety gear we should always wear:

Helmets: Protecting our head is paramount. A good-quality hard hat can shield us from impacts and falling objects. For instance, a helmet designed for heavy equipment operators often includes built-in ear protection, which can be invaluable in noisy environments.

Gloves: Our hands are involved in virtually every aspect of tractor operation. Wearing durable gloves not only provides grip on the controls but also protects our hands from cuts, abrasions, and vibrations from prolonged use. For example, reinforced work gloves like the Mechanix Wear M-Pact offer excellent flexibility along with impact protection.

Eye Protection: The tractor’s environment can expose us to dust, flying debris, and bright glare. Safety goggles or glasses with side shields are easy to find and can significantly reduce the risk of eye injuries. Look for products that meet ANSI Z87.1 standards for optimal protection.

Steel-Toed Boots: Our feet are just as vulnerable as our hands and eyes. Steel-toed boots not only protect against heavy objects that may drop but also offer good grip and support while we’re on the move around the tractor. Brands like Wolverine and Red Wing produce robust options designed for long-lasting comfort and protection.

The Impact of PPE in Real-World Scenarios

Consider a situation where an operator is transferring materials with their John Deere tractor—like hay bales or construction supplies. Without steel-toed boots, a misplaced step could result in serious toe injuries from heavy items. Similarly, operating in a dusty field without safety goggles could lead to eye irritation or injury, making it difficult to maintain focus on the task at hand.

Data indicates that wearing safety gear can reduce the severity of injuries in workplaces like farms and construction sites by over 50%. This staggering number underscores the importance of taking precautionary measures every time we operate the tractor.

Tip 3: Conduct Pre-Operation Safety Inspections

Before climbing into the cab of our John Deere tractor, we must take a moment to conduct a thorough pre-operation safety inspection. This proactive approach not only safeguards our well-being but also protects our machinery from potential damage. By following a structured checklist, we set ourselves up for success and ensure our equipment is operating at its best.

The Importance of Pre-Operation Checks

Think about it: starting our work without inspecting the machinery is like setting off on a road trip without checking the car. Just as we wouldn’t want to hit the highway with an empty gas tank or a flat tire, we shouldn’t start our tractor without ensuring everything is in good working condition. Simple checks can prevent accidents and costly repairs, saving us both time and money in the long run.

Essential Pre-Operation Checklist

Here’s a comprehensive checklist we can follow:

Fluid Levels: Check engine oil, coolant, hydraulic fluid, and fuel levels. Running low can cause serious mechanical issues. For instance, did you know that low hydraulic fluid can lead to decreased lifting power, potentially affecting our ability to operate attachments?

Brakes: Test the brakes to ensure they engage smoothly and effectively. This is critical when navigating slopes or handling heavy loads. Remember a story last summer when a lack of brake inspection led to a near-miss on a hillside. Let’s avoid such close calls!

Lights: Always inspect headlights, taillights, and turn signals. Proper visibility is vital, especially if we’re working in low-light conditions or alongside other vehicles on the farm.

Tires: Examine tire pressure and tread depth. Underinflated tires can decrease traction, while worn tires diminish stability. Keeping tires in good shape is especially crucial during muddy conditions, where traction is everything.

Safety Features: Ensure all safety features, including the roll-over protective structures (ROPS) and seatbelts, are functioning. These elements are our best defense against serious accidents.

Attachments and Tools: Assess any attachments we plan to use. Securing them properly and checking their condition can prevent unexpected detachments that could cause accidents.

Tip 4: Mastering the Controls and Features

John Deere tractors are marvels of modern engineering, designed with advanced technology and controls that not only enhance our productivity but also significantly improve safety. By taking the time to understand the various controls and features available, we can operate our tractors more efficiently while reducing the likelihood of accidents caused by operator error.

Understanding the Dashboard

The dashboard of our John Deere tractor is not just a display; it’s our command center. Familiarizing ourselves with each gauge and indicator will allow us to monitor critical operational parameters in real time.

Tachometer: This displays the engine speed and helps us manage power efficiently. Understanding how to operate within the optimal RPM range can save fuel and extend engine life.

Temperature Gauges: Keeping an eye on these can alert us to potential overheating, ensuring we address cooling issues before they sabotage our workday.

Warning Lights: Specific signals indicate problems such as oil pressure issues or low fluid levels. Knowing what these alerts mean—and acting on them immediately—can prevent minor issues from becoming major breakdowns.

Mastering Controls for Safe Operation

Operating a tractor involves various controls that may seem intimidating at first, but practicing mastery over them is essential for our safety. Here’s a closer look at some of the crucial components:

Throttle Control: This regulates engine speed. A good practice is to start at a lower RPM and gradually increase it as needed to prevent jolting movements that could lead to accidents.

Steering System: Familiarizing ourselves with the steering wheel and any additional control knobs will help ensure smooth navigation, especially when making tight turns or working in confined spaces.

Hydraulic Controls: Many attachments like loaders or backhoes operate through hydraulic controls. Mastering these allows us to raise, lower, and tilt attachments with precision. Practice doing this at varying speeds until it feels second nature.

Utilizing Advanced Features

Many modern John Deere tractor models come equipped with automated systems for added convenience and safety:

Auto-Trac: This GPS guidance system helps us maintain straight lines when plowing or planting, which not only improves efficiency but also minimizes accidents caused by misalignment.

Load-Sensing Technology: This feature optimizes hydraulic flow, ensuring that machinery remains stable even under heavy loads. Understanding this feature can prevent incidents related to “overlifting,” which can easily lead to tipping.

Integrated Safety Features: Many models include features like automatic shut-off systems if seat belts aren’t fastened, or rollover protection systems (ROPS). Knowing how these systems work and when to rely on them can be crucial during operation.

Tip 5: Implement Safe Operating Practices

Having mastered our John Deere tractor’s controls and features, the next step is to implement safe operating practices that enhance our safety and that of others around us. These best practices encompass maintaining a secure work environment, being aware of our surroundings, and fully understanding our equipment’s limitations. By adopting these habits, we can transform our operational experience into one that prioritizes safety and efficiency.

Establishing a Safe Work Environment

Creating a safe work environment begins long before we climb into the cab. We’re talking about being proactive in ensuring our surroundings are clear of hazards:

Maintain Clear Pathways: Always ensure that our work area is free of obstacles and debris. Not only does this minimize the risk of collisions, but it also allows us to navigate more efficiently. Trust us, there’s nothing like the eerie feeling of an unseen obstruction when operating heavy machinery at speed.

Designate Operating Zones: Clearly mark areas where tractors will be operating, especially when working near other employees, livestock, or equipment. Warning signs and tape can help keep everyone informed and safe.

Communicate Effectively: Establish a communication protocol with team members when working in proximity. Utilizing hand signals, radios, or even mobile apps can ensure everyone is on the same page, reducing anxiety and accidents.

Understanding the Limitations of Our Equipment

Every tractor, including our cherished John Deere, has specific capabilities and limitations. Familiarizing ourselves with these aspects is vital:

Know the Weight Limits: Each implement and attachment comes with a weight capacity. Exceeding this limit can cause tipping or loss of control. Let’s keep those heavy loads within limits, as the consequences of going overboard can be severe—not just for the equipment but for our safety as well.

Watch for Slopes and Inclines: Operations on slopes require extra caution. It’s essential we understand the center of gravity and how it shifts based on our load and the angle of inclination. For instance, did you know that working on a 15-degree slope can double the risk of rollover compared to flat ground? Avoid unnecessary risks by verifying ground conditions.

Adjust Operating Speed: Safe driving speeds must be maintained based on the terrain and load. We should never rush; it’s essential to throttle down when turning or navigating tight corners. A good rule of thumb is to err on the side of caution—if we feel uncertain, we should slow down.

Awareness of our surroundings is crucial to safe tractor operation. Here’s how to enhance our observational skills:

Use Mirrors Effectively: Adjust our side and rearview mirrors to minimize blind spots. A well-positioned mirror can give us a clear view of our surroundings, helping us spot potential hazards and other workers more easily.

Scan for Hazards: Develop the habit of scanning the area around us before moving the tractor. Spotting an unexpected hole or a stray animal can make all the difference.

Limit Distractions: Stay focused on the task at hand. This means avoiding distractions such as mobile phones or loud music. A moment’s inattention could lead to costly mistakes.
